The mention of investing in small & microcap stocks may initially raise some red flags. However, one must remember that any investment carries a great deal of risk and uncertainty, but the prepared investor will do the research and make a sound decision for their portfolio. A smallcap stock typically has a market cap of $300 million to $2 billion, while a microcap company falls in the $50 million to $300 million range. Although these smaller-scaled companies are viewed as young and volatile, they also bring many potential investment benefits.
